Fault Codes:Hitachi ZX470-5B 11005-2
What is Hitachi ZX470-5B Fault Code 11005-2?
Fault Code 11005-2 indicates a malfunction in the fuel injection system's common rail pressure sensor circuit, specifically a low voltage or short-to-ground condition. This diagnostic trouble code (DTC) is triggered when the Electronic Control Module (ECM) detects that the common rail pressure sensor is sending voltage signals below the manufacturer's specified threshold, typically under 0.5 volts for more than 2 seconds during operation.
The common rail pressure sensor is critical for the ZX470-5B's HINO J05E engine performance. It continuously monitors fuel pressure in the common rail system (typically 1,600-1,800 bar at full load) and sends real-time data to the ECM. When this sensor circuit fails, the ECM cannot properly regulate fuel injection timing and quantity, leading to significant performance degradation and potential engine protection modes.
Common Symptoms
- Engine derate mode activated, limiting maximum RPM to approximately 1,200-1,500 RPM and reducing hydraulic system performance by 30-40%
- Yellow warning light illuminated on the instrument cluster with possible "Check Engine" message on the monitor display
- Rough idling or unstable engine operation, particularly noticeable during cold starts
- Black or white smoke from the exhaust due to improper fuel-air mixture ratios
- Hard starting conditions requiring extended cranking periods, especially after the machine has sat overnight
Potential Causes
The most common causes for Code 11005-2 on used ZX470-5B excavators include:
- Damaged wiring harness between the common rail pressure sensor and ECM, particularly at harness routing points near the engine mount brackets where vibration causes insulation wear
- Corroded or contaminated connector pins at the sensor plug (3-pin connector), often caused by water intrusion through deteriorated connector seals
- Failed common rail pressure sensor itself, with internal circuit breakdown—common after 8,000+ operating hours
- ECM internal fault affecting the sensor circuit power supply or ground reference
- Chafed wires rubbing against the fuel injection pump housing or valve cover due to improper harness retention
How to Troubleshoot and Fix Code 11005-2
Step 1: Visual Inspection Disconnect the battery. Inspect the common rail pressure sensor connector (located on the fuel rail assembly near cylinder #1) for corrosion, bent pins, or moisture. Check the entire sensor harness routing from sensor to ECM for visible damage, particularly where it passes over the engine block near mounting points.
Step 2: Electrical Testing Using a digital multimeter, backprobe the sensor connector with ignition ON/engine OFF. Verify sensor supply voltage at pin 1 reads 4.8-5.2 volts. Check ground circuit continuity at pin 2 (should read less than 1 ohm to chassis ground). Measure signal wire resistance from pin 3 to ECM connector—should be under 5 ohms.
Step 3: Sensor and Component Testing If voltage supply and ground are correct, measure sensor output voltage with the engine running at idle—should read 0.8-1.2 volts. If readings are out of specification or erratic, replace the common rail pressure sensor (Hitachi part number varies by engine serial). For used excavators, always apply dielectric grease to connector pins during reassembly to prevent future corrosion.
Step 4: Advanced Diagnostics If all electrical values are correct but the code persists, use Hitachi Dr.EX diagnostic software to monitor live sensor data and compare actual rail pressure versus commanded pressure. Discrepancies may indicate ECM calibration issues or mechanical fuel system problems requiring dealer-level support.
